    Texture can completely transform a design and give it a whole new aesthetic, and luckily they can be created easily in Adobe Photoshop. We’ll take you through 3 different methods of creating 3 different styles of distressed texture, as well as showing you how you can apply them to any design you’re working on in a non-destructive way. By the end of the video you’ll be able to create a stamp effect, halftone, and photorealistic grit texture pack, all of which can be customised and fine-tuned to your heart's content.
